About Trademark Law in Kathmandu, Nepal

Trademark law in Kathmandu, Nepal, provides legal protection to businesses or individuals who want to protect their distinctive signs, logos, or symbols that they use to identify and differentiate their goods or services from others in the marketplace. These trademarks can include words, names, slogans, logos, or even packaging elements. Registering a trademark in Kathmandu, Nepal, is an important step to safeguard your intellectual property and prevent others from using it without permission.

Local Laws Overview

In Kathmandu, Nepal, trademark law is primarily governed by the Trademark Act and its corresponding regulations. Some key aspects of the local laws relevant to trademarks include:

  • Trademark eligibility: Certain marks, such as those that are generic, descriptive, or likely to cause confusion with existing trademarks, may be ineligible for registration.
  • Trademark registration process: To obtain trademark protection, applicants must file an application with the Department of Industries, Intellectual Property Office, along with the required documentation and fees.
  • Trademark duration: Registered trademarks in Kathmandu, Nepal, are initially valid for ten years from the date of filing and can be renewed indefinitely in ten-year intervals.
  • Trademark enforcement: In case of trademark infringement, the trademark owner can take legal action to obtain remedies such as injunctions, damages, and seizure of infringing goods.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I trademark a business name in Kathmandu, Nepal?

Yes, you can trademark a business name in Kathmandu, Nepal, as long as it meets the eligibility criteria for trademarks and is not identical or confusingly similar to existing marks.

2. How long does the trademark registration process take?

The trademark registration process in Kathmandu, Nepal, typically takes around 6 to 12 months, provided there are no oppositions or objections during the examination period.

3. Do I need to use my trademark before applying for registration?

No, actual use of the trademark is not required for filing a trademark application in Kathmandu, Nepal. However, it is necessary to use the mark within five years of registration to maintain its validity.

4. Can I protect my trademark internationally through registration in Kathmandu, Nepal?

No, a trademark registration in Kathmandu, Nepal, provides protection only within the country's borders. To protect your trademark internationally, you will need to file separate applications in each desired country or consider regional trademark systems.

5. What are the potential consequences of trademark infringement in Kathmandu, Nepal?

Trademark infringement can lead to legal consequences, including injunctions, damages, account of profits, and the seizure and destruction of infringing goods. It is important to take prompt action to protect your trademark rights.
